Ensuring Security and Privacy in Government Transactions

In today’s digital age, more people are handling government-related tasks online. From filing taxes to renewing licenses, these transactions often involve sharing personal and sensitive information. Ensuring the security and privacy of this data is crucial to protect individuals from threats like identity theft and fraud. This article explores the importance of security measures in government transactions and how they help safeguard personal information.


The Importance of Data Protection

When you interact with government services online, you often provide details like your Social Security number, financial information, and other personal data. If this information falls into the wrong hands, it can lead to serious consequences such as financial loss or compromised personal identity. Therefore, robust security protocols are essential to keep this information safe from unauthorized access.

Ensuring Security and Privacy in Government Transactions

Key Security Measures

Several standard security practices are implemented to protect online government transactions:

Bank-Level Encryption

Encryption is a method of converting information into a code to prevent unauthorized access. Bank-level encryption, such as 256-bit TLS (Transport Layer Security), is one of the most secure encryption methods available. It ensures that data transmitted between your device and the server remains confidential and cannot be intercepted by third parties.


Malware Protection

Malware, including viruses and spyware, can infiltrate systems and steal personal information. Using industry-leading security software helps detect and block these malicious programs. Regular updates and real-time scanning are vital components of effective malware protection.

PCI Compliance

The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ard (PCI DSS) sets requirements for organizations that handle credit card information. Compliance with PCI DSS ensures that payment processes are secure, reducing the risk of financial data being compromised during transactions.

Multi-Factor Authentication

Multi-factor authentication (MFA) adds an extra layer of security by requiring users to provide two or more verification factors to access an account. This might include something you know (a password), something you have (a mobile device), or something you are (fingerprint or facial recognition). MFA makes it much harder for unauthorized users to gain access.


Protecting User Privacy

Beyond technical security measures, protecting user privacy involves policies and practices that govern how personal information is handled.

Privacy Policies

Clear and transparent privacy policies inform users about what data is collected, how it is used, and who it is shared with. Organizations committed to privacy will not trade or sell personal data and will only use it for the intended purposes.

Dedicated Security Teams

Having a team dedicated to security means there are professionals continuously monitoring systems for potential threats. They can respond quickly to any suspicious activity and implement measures to prevent breaches.


User Notifications

Keeping users informed about their account activities adds an extra layer of protection. Notifications about logins from new devices or changes to account settings can alert users to unauthorized access promptly.

Best Practices for Users

While organizations implement security measures, users also play a role in protecting their information.

  • Use Strong Passwords: Create complex passwords that are difficult to guess and use different passwords for different accounts.
  • Keep Software Updated: Regular updates often include security patches that protect against new threats.
  • Be Cautious with Personal Information: Only provide sensitive data on secure websites (look for “https://” and a padlock icon in the address bar).
  • Monitor Accounts Regularly: Check your accounts for any unusual activity and report discrepancies immediately.
